WE WORSHIP god in innumerable forms, as his manifestations are innumerable. But there is one long documented question that sometimes overwhelm me in wonder and sometimes stuns me. And that is- ‘why should I pray’? 

Some do it for self realisation, while others do it to see god face to face and attain ‘moksha’ (salvation). But I am still on my way to discover the absolute truth. As I have not yet found him, but I am still looking for him. And it is right to chase the reason as far as one could. 

The more deeper I go into the thought, the more perplexed I become. I sometimes wonder is ‘god just an idea’, who was invented by someone to frighten people into subservience to the prevailing structure of power. Or to provide ease in times of fear and distress. I find myself totally submissive referring to him as being. I feel the need to understand the dimensions of this eternal truth. 

The very existence of god is indefinable. No one knows how, where and why god exists. And if his very existence is uncertain, then do we pray to Lord for faith alone? Is it true that we are more protected by his grace and not by our work and good deeds? What is that extra credit, which one acquires while praising Lord? Will I commit a sin if I don’t worship him? 

And if I do, will it benefit me in any way? Will worshipping Lord really help me elevate my status in the paradise? Should we believe that ‘god alone is real and all else is unreal’? After analysing all these facts, should I bow before the Lord as a big question mark? Or is it better to go as far as the reason could take me?
